Judas Tree and Clarkia concinna Physical Information

Judas Tree and Clarkia concinna physical information is very important for comparison. Judas Tree height is 450.00 cm and width 454.00 cm whereas Clarkia concinna height is 25.40 cm and width 25.40 cm. The color specification of Judas Tree and Clarkia concinna are as follows:

  • Judas Tree flower color: Light Purple, Pink and White

  • Judas Tree leaf color: Green and Dark Green

  • Clarkia concinna flower color: Pink, Fuchsia, Rose and Lavender

  • Clarkia concinna leaf color: Green and Gray Green
